According to statistics conducted by American designers, about 21% of all homeowners in the United States today choose Transitional to decorate their rooms. And that makes it the most popular style in the country! “Transitional style” is a combination of classic elements with modern ones. Harmony between elegance and clean lines, subtle color palette, sleek details, mirrors and streamlined lighting.

There is no place for exuberant colors in the Transitional style. This is very often a beige interior, the pros and cons of which the portal has already written about. Other primary colors are gray, cream, brown. Blue, burgundy, light green are added as a contrast. In general, the “transitional style” contains mostly natural, woody and earthy hues..

There are many natural materials in the interior decoration of Transitional – stone, ceramic tiles, wood. Of the metals, brass and copper are often used, worn, aged nickel, silver and bronze details can be found.

In the American classics, there is a very pronounced craving for symmetry. Furniture items are often mirrored. This is especially noticeable in the living room, where two identical sofas opposite each other are the most common arrangement. In the same way, there are two armchairs, you can find mirrors on opposite walls and two beds in the children’s room..

It is not difficult to choose furniture for the “transitional style”. These are sloping pieces of furniture, without sharp straight lines and sharp corners. Often used are carriage braces, soft headboards, metal rivets on chairs and armchairs. Carving is not so common, but it can be present selectively as a decoration.

Upholstery fabrics are very different – worn leather, knitted items, velvet, tweed, silk, corduroy, suede. And the patterns are simple, low-contrast, just a background.

The Transitional style ceilings are traditionally white, high, with a wide cornice. Sometimes there are coffered ceilings, which give the rooms a more formal and classic look. Walls are most often simply painted in light colors, wallpapers are quite rare.

In the “transitional style” there are many table and pendant lamps, often the center of the ceiling is occupied by a chandelier with pendants, but it is never the only source of illumination.

Decor items in the Transitional style are vintage items, paintings, mirrors, modern candlesticks, vases. A lot of decorations are not needed, these are point elements that simply complement the picture and bring individuality to the interior.

In general, according to the designers, the Transitional style is very simple, you can create it yourself without the help of professionals. And the finishing is inexpensive, and the furniture is not difficult to pick up. And the general impression is very calm, cozy, pleasant. Apparently, this is why the “transitional style” remains the most popular in the United States..
